Yosemite Valley

Art Appreciation

This breathtaking landscape captures a serene valley framed by towering cliffs and lush trees, bathed in a soft, almost divine light streaming through a patchy sky. The artist’s masterful use of light and shadow creates a luminous atmosphere that imbues the scene with a sense of awe and tranquility. The delicate interplay between the sunlight filtering through the clouds and the gentle reflections on the water surface invites the viewer to feel the crisp mountain air and the quiet stillness of this natural haven.

The composition is carefully balanced, with the rugged cliffs on the right and the softly rolling hills on the left guiding the eye toward the distant peak bathed in light. The muted, natural color palette of greens, browns, and grays enhances the realism while evoking a peaceful, almost spiritual reverence for the wilderness. Small figures and animals in the foreground add scale and a touch of human presence, reminding us of our place within this majestic environment. Created during the mid-19th century, this work reflects the grandeur of American Romanticism and the Hudson River School’s dedication to celebrating the sublime beauty of the American West.
